The Connection Between Asbestos and Lung Cancer

Asbestos is a naturally happening mineral that was frequently made use of in building and construction materials, automobile products, and different industrial applications, especially before the dangers were totally recognized. In Louisiana Lung Cancer Asbestos, industries such as oil refining, shipbuilding, and building have traditionally used asbestos, resulting in differing degrees of exposure for workers and citizens.

How Asbestos Causes Lung Cancer

When breathed in, asbestos fibers can cause significant damage to lung tissue, causing swelling and cellular changes with time. This damage can result in lung cancer, especially in people exposed to asbestos who are heavy cigarette smokers. According to studies, the risk of lung cancer increases significantly in people with a double history of asbestos exposure and smoking cigarettes.

Factors Influencing Prognosis

  1. Stage of Cancer: Lung cancer staging ranges from localized (confined to the lungs) to distant (infect other organs). Early detection significantly improves survival rates.
  2. Type of Lung Cancer: The two primary types are small cell lung cancer (SCLC) and non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C). NSCLC has typically much better prognosis results.
  3. Health Status: Patients' general health, lifestyle choices, and any pre-existing conditions contribute considerably to treatment efficacy and prognosis.
  4. Tumor Characteristics: Genetic anomalies and other tumor markers play a necessary function in personalizing treatment strategies-- targeted treatments can enhance outcomes for particular anomaly types.

Treatment Options Available in Louisiana

Treatment options for lung cancer mainly consist of:

  1. Surgery: Removal of the tumor and surrounding tissue can be alleviative in early-stage lung cancer.
  2. Radiation Therapy: Often utilized post-surgery or as a main treatment for those who can not undergo surgery.
  3. Chemotherapy: Commonly advised for sophisticated cancers or in combination with other treatments.
  4. Targeted Therapy: Newer treatments intended at genetic modifications in cells are increasingly appearing.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)

What are the symptoms of lung cancer?

Typical symptoms of lung cancer include:

  • Persistent cough
  • Spending blood
  • Chest pain
  • Shortness of breath
  • Inexplicable weight-loss
  • Fatigue

How is lung cancer detected in Louisiana?

Diagnosis usually starts with a thorough medical history and health examination, followed by imaging tests (such as X-rays or CT scans) and biopsy treatments to confirm the existence of cancer cells.

Exists any compensation available for asbestos-related lung cancer patients?

Yes, clients identified with lung cancer due to asbestos exposure may be qualified for compensation through legal claims against companies that made or mandated asbestos use without appropriate safety precautions.

What can reduce the risk of lung cancer if somebody has been exposed to asbestos?

While there is no surefire way to avoid lung cancer post-exposure, factors that may minimize risk include:

  • Quitting cigarette smoking
  • Avoiding pre-owned smoke
  • Regular medical check-ups and screenings
  • Maintaining a healthy diet and workout routine
